Cyberpunk / Dark Sci-Fi

Description

Cyberpunk / dark sci-fi refers to science fiction with an explicitly dark and/or moody tone. This style is sometimes modeled around the concept of a "cyberpunk", or a human individual in the future who can interact directly with computers or a computer network, often working alone against an evil corporation or computer AI.
